A Site with a View

A spacious site with views, new landscaping and good sized pitches many of which are serviced. There is some background noise which can be partly avoided by pitching near the camping area. This is a good site for families with a big playing field, woods, water and just across the woodland bridge a mini assault course. Also an excellent dog walk, dog/cycle wash and an easy use grid for motorhome waste water. Early birds get the croissants and rolls in the well stocked shop. Local walks are great. The small "Around and About Brecon" map from the office or Brecon tourism in town shows all the local routes easily reached from the site including the Taff Trail and Usk Walks.. It's only a few minutes walk down from the site to the Monmouthshire and Brecon Canal, then a half an hour stroll into Brecon one way or the Brynich Lock in the other. On reaching Brecon there is a good cafe at the the theatre (another nearby) and boat hire. There are nearby beautiful walks along the Usk river too.The woodland and lane walk from the site to the dog friendly Three Horseshoes pub is about 15 minutes. An enjoyable walk to a modern pub with good food.  Overall a site worth visiting with plenty to do in the area on foot, cycling or by car.

Excellent facilities

We have been tent camping for over 30 years in the UK and Europe but this was our first time as caravaners.  In all that time we have never seen such excellent washroom facilities!  A good site for exploring the area and the nearby pub served a brilliant Sunday lunch.  Staff were very pleasant and helpful.  We were sited near the playing field so away from the A40 and very quiet but I imagine the noise could have been a problem on pitches at the bottom end of the site.

Good views and walks

Large site but hedges separating the pitches make it seem a lot smaller. As others have mentioned canal walk into Brecon takes about 20 minutes, an alternative, you can walk along the canal away from Brecon and there is a signposted walk to your left which takes you along and closer to the bank of the river obviously t takes longer.

Good base for the Beacons

Excellent all round site. Facilities are first class. Gentle canalside walk/ cycle into Brecon along the canal. A great centre to explore the wonderful Brecon Beacons or the Brecon to Monmouth canal. However if you dont have your own transport the buses though can be spasmodic and non existent on a Sunday, so weekdays are best. A walkers bus circulating around the main walking sites would be ideal. The sigposted walk to the pub is worth it for the views of PenyFan, Cribyn and Corn Du alone.

Lovely Site

Had a great week at Brecon. Spotless site, lovely wardens, great pitch with plenty of space. My son loved the play field which was beautifully kept and the stream at the side of the site in a wooded area gave him hours of fun and me loads of washing :-). Next door to the site is a large soft play barn which was a great refuge when the weather isn't great serving coffees and a limited menu. Didn't eat there so can't comment. £5 for my ten year old but it wore him out so didn't mind. The shower block near reception appeared to be brand new and lovely and warm, always immaculate. Fantastic site shop with great selection of food, toiletries etc and lots if caravan 'bits'. Five minute walk through the wooded lane to a fab pub serving really great food. Highly recommend but need to book as it gets busy.  Ten minute walk along the canal into Brecon. Not much there but a nice walk. Two supermarkets 5 mins drive away. Beautiful setting. Very easy approach as right next to A40 and that's the only negative I have but as I'd read other reviews we were aware of it before we booked. Would happily return. Pitches near play field were less noisy.
